Fiduciary Assignment of Receivables definition

Fiduciary Assignment of Receivables means an Indonesian law deed of fiduciary security (jaminan fidusia) over the Borrower’s rights under the Charter Documents, the Building Contract Documents, the Mooring Documents, the Vessel Rights and the Guarantee Rights executed by the Borrower in favour of the Security Agent in the agreed form;
Fiduciary Assignment of Receivables means one of the Brazilian Securities to be granted by the Brazilian Guarantor by means of a fiduciary assignment of receivables as further described in the Fiduciary Assignment of Receivables Agreement.
Fiduciary Assignment of Receivables means the Indonesian law governed fiduciary assignment to be entered into on or prior to the Closing Date between the Senior Secured Parties (as represented by the Onshore Security Agent) and the Borrower Entities in respect of all present and future receivables of the Borrower Entities.
